NewDiscover the Future of Reading! Introducing our revolutionary product for avid readers: Reads Ebooks Online. Dive into a new chapter today! Check it out

Write Sign In
Reads Ebooks OnlineReads Ebooks Online
Write
Sign In
Member-only story

Unlock the Power of Unity: Master Advanced Tips and Techniques for Professional-Grade Game Development

Jese Leos
·18.8k Followers· Follow
Published in Mastering Unity Scripting: Learn Advanced C# Tips And Techniques To Make Professional Grade Games With Unity
5 min read
458 View Claps
88 Respond
Save
Listen
Share

Are you an aspiring game developer looking to take your skills to the next level? Look no further! In this article, we will explore advanced tips and techniques to help you create professional-grade games with Unity, a powerful and widely-used game development engine. From optimizing performance to mastering advanced scripting, we have got you covered.

Why Unity?

Unity has revolutionized the game development industry, allowing developers of all levels to create stunning games with ease. Its versatility, user-friendly interface, and extensive library of features have made it a go-to tool for both indie developers and large game studios. Whether you aim to create a mobile game, a virtual reality experience, or a console masterpiece, Unity is your one-stop solution.

Optimizing Game Performance

Creating a seamless and visually appealing gaming experience requires optimizing your game's performance. This section will delve into various techniques that will help you achieve efficient resource management, smooth frame rates, and quick load times.

Mastering Unity Scripting: Learn advanced C# tips and techniques to make professional grade games with Unity
Mastering Unity Scripting: Learn advanced C# tips and techniques to make professional-grade games with Unity
by Alan Thorn(Kindle Edition)

4.5 out of 5

Language : English
File size : 31079 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
Print length : 381 pages
Item Weight : 7 ounces
Dimensions : 5.98 x 0.63 x 8.27 inches

From analyzing and minimizing draw calls to utilizing occlusion culling and level of detail techniques, we will walk you through each step of the optimization process. Learn how to strike the perfect balance between aesthetics and performance, ensuring that your game runs flawlessly on a variety of devices.

Advanced Scripting Techniques

Scripting is the backbone of game development, enabling you to bring your ideas to life. This section will dive deep into advanced scripting techniques using C# in Unity. Discover how to efficiently manage complex code structures, implement artificial intelligence, and create dynamic and responsive game mechanics.

We will explore topics such as scriptable objects, coroutines, and event-driven programming to enhance your game's functionality and create immersive gameplay experiences. With these advanced scripting techniques, you will have the power to develop intricate and innovative games that captivate your players.

Creating Realistic Environments

Visuals play a significant role in the success of a game. This section will guide you through the process of creating realistic and immersive environments in Unity. Learn essential techniques for creating detailed terrains, dynamic lighting, and stunning particle effects.

Discover the secrets behind realistic water simulations, advanced shader programming, and intricate level design. By the end of this section, you will have the expertise to build breathtaking worlds that draw players into your game's universe.

Implementing Multiplayer Functionality

Multiplayer functionality is essential for many modern games, allowing players to connect and compete in real-time. In this section, we will explore how to implement multiplayer features in Unity, opening doors to limitless possibilities.

Whether you want to create local multiplayer experiences or connect players globally through various networking technologies, we will provide you with the knowledge and tools needed for successful implementation. Get ready to elevate your game's excitement factor by enabling multiplayer gameplay.

Maximizing Audio Immersion

Audio is an often overlooked aspect of game development, yet it can greatly enhance the overall player experience. In this section, we will cover advanced techniques for implementing captivating audio in Unity.

Learn how to create dynamic soundscapes, interactive music systems, and realistic spatial audio to further immerse players in your game. Master the art of audio integration and discover the psychological impact sound can have on gameplay.

Expanding Your Knowledge

Unity is a constantly evolving platform, with new features and updates being released regularly. This section will introduce you to reliable resources and communities where you can expand your knowledge and stay up-to-date with the latest advancements in Unity game development.

From official Unity documentation and video tutorials to online forums and game development courses, we will cover a range of valuable resources that will fuel your journey towards becoming a master game developer.

With Unity, the possibilities are endless. By implementing the advanced tips and techniques explored in this article, you will have the power to create professional-grade games that captivate and engage players.

Unlock the full potential of Unity and take your game development skills to new heights. Embrace the challenges, experiment with innovative ideas, and never stop learning. Your journey to becoming a professional game developer starts here.

Mastering Unity Scripting: Learn advanced C# tips and techniques to make professional grade games with Unity
Mastering Unity Scripting: Learn advanced C# tips and techniques to make professional-grade games with Unity
by Alan Thorn(Kindle Edition)

4.5 out of 5

Language : English
File size : 31079 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
Print length : 381 pages
Item Weight : 7 ounces
Dimensions : 5.98 x 0.63 x 8.27 inches

Learn advanced C# tips and techniques to make professional-grade games with Unity

About This Book

  • Packed with hands-on tasks and real-world scenarios that will help you apply C# concepts
  • Learn how to work with event-driven programming, regular expressions, customized rendering, AI, and lots more
  • Easy-to-follow structure and language, which will help you understand advanced ideas

Who This Book Is For

Mastering Unity Scripting is an advanced book intended for students, educators, and professionals familiar with the Unity basics as well as the basics of scripting. Whether you've been using Unity for a short time or are an experienced user, this book has something important and valuable to offer to help you improve your game development workflow.

What You Will Learn

  • Understand core C# concepts, such as class inheritance, interfaces, singletons, and static objects
  • Implement effective Artificial Intelligence for NPCs
  • Work with event-driven programming to optimize your code
  • Develop solid debugging and diagnostic techniques
  • Get to know the Mono Framework and Linq in practical contexts
  • Customize the rendering functionality for postprocess effects
  • Code line of sight, view testing, and other useful algorithms
  • Improve the quality of your code with the help of concepts such as attributes

In Detail

This book is an easy-to-follow guide that introduces you to advanced tips and techniques to code Unity games in C#. Using practical and hands-on examples across ten comprehensive chapters, you'll learn how C# can be applied creatively to build professional-grade games that sell.

You will be able to create impressive Artificial Intelligence for enemy characters, customize camera rendering for postprocess effects, and improve scene management by understanding component-based architecture. In addition, you will have an in-depth look at the .NET classes used to increase program reliability, see how to process datasets such as CSV files, and understand how to run advanced queries on data. By the end of this book, you'll become a powerful Unity developer, equipped with plenty of tools and techniques to quickly and effectively develop merchantable games.

Read full of this story with a FREE account.
Already have an account? Sign in
458 View Claps
88 Respond
Save
Listen
Share
Recommended from Reads Ebooks Online
Compulsion Heidi Ayarbe
Drew Bell profile pictureDrew Bell
·4 min read
1.8k View Claps
95 Respond
The Cottonmouth Club: A Novel
Guy Powell profile pictureGuy Powell

The Cottonmouth Club Novel - Uncovering the Secrets of a...

Welcome to the dark and twisted world of...

·4 min read
357 View Claps
44 Respond
Affirming Diversity: The Sociopolitical Context Of Multicultural Education (2 Downloads) (What S New In Foundations / Intro To Teaching)
Ira Cox profile pictureIra Cox

The Sociopolitical Context Of Multicultural Education...

Living in a diverse and interconnected world,...

·5 min read
271 View Claps
23 Respond
FACING SUNSET: 3800 SOLO MILES A WOMAN S JOURNEY BACK AND FORWARD
Jesse Bell profile pictureJesse Bell
·6 min read
352 View Claps
41 Respond
Florida Irrigation Sprinkler Contractor: 2019 Study Review Practice Exams For PROV Exam
Cody Blair profile pictureCody Blair
·4 min read
821 View Claps
90 Respond
Getting Political: Scenes From A Life In Israel
Walt Whitman profile pictureWalt Whitman

Unveiling the Political Tapestry: Life in Israel

Israel, a vibrant country located in the...

·5 min read
411 View Claps
27 Respond
Life History And The Historical Moment: Diverse Presentations
Allan James profile pictureAllan James
·4 min read
1.6k View Claps
100 Respond
Miami South Beach The Delaplaine 2022 Long Weekend Guide
George Bernard Shaw profile pictureGeorge Bernard Shaw
·5 min read
273 View Claps
21 Respond
Principles Of The Law Of Real Property
Edison Mitchell profile pictureEdison Mitchell
·5 min read
1.3k View Claps
99 Respond
LSAT PrepTest 76 Unlocked: Exclusive Data Analysis Explanations For The October 2015 LSAT (Kaplan Test Prep)
Caleb Carter profile pictureCaleb Carter
·4 min read
1k View Claps
90 Respond
No 1 Mum: A Celebration Of Motherhood
Alexandre Dumas profile pictureAlexandre Dumas
·4 min read
1.4k View Claps
88 Respond
Race Walking Record 913 October 2021
Wesley Reed profile pictureWesley Reed

Race Walking Record 913 October 2021

Are you ready for an...

·4 min read
211 View Claps
11 Respond

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!

Good Author
  • Yasunari Kawabata profile picture
    Yasunari Kawabata
    Follow ·10.2k
  • Oliver Foster profile picture
    Oliver Foster
    Follow ·2.5k
  • Joel Mitchell profile picture
    Joel Mitchell
    Follow ·4.6k
  • Denzel Hayes profile picture
    Denzel Hayes
    Follow ·10.1k
  • Gerald Parker profile picture
    Gerald Parker
    Follow ·3.9k
  • Terry Pratchett profile picture
    Terry Pratchett
    Follow ·13.6k
  • Avery Simmons profile picture
    Avery Simmons
    Follow ·6.2k
  • Henry James profile picture
    Henry James
    Follow ·14.8k
Sign up for our newsletter and stay up to date!

By subscribing to our newsletter, you'll receive valuable content straight to your inbox, including informative articles, helpful tips, product launches, and exciting promotions.

By subscribing, you agree with our Privacy Policy.


© 2023 Reads Ebooks Online™ is a registered trademark. All Rights Reserved.